Haskovec Joins Team Valvoline EMGO Suzuki

Team Valvoline EMGO Suzuki has signed Vincent Haskovec to race the 2004 season. Haskovec was born in the Czech Republic but came to the USA seven years ago to start his racing career. The 29-year-old is a legal resident of the United States and is in the process of becoming a naturalized American citizen. He currently resides in Lake Elsinore, California.

Haskovec caught the attention of the team during the 2003 season, regularly battling with Team Valvoline EMGO Suzuki’s Steve Rapp for top honors in the Superstock class. He finished third in the championship with five podiums, including a victory at Road Atlanta. Haskovec is very eager to join the team.

Haskovec will race a Suzuki GSX-R600 in the revamped Formula Xtreme class and will also compete in another class to be determined. Rapp, who re-signed with the team for 2004 during his successful 2003 season, will race in Supersport and a class to be determined.

Both riders will test with Michelin this Thursday, Friday, and Saturday (December 4-6) at Daytona International Speedway.
